Understanding TS EAMCET Participating Colleges and Counseling Categories

The Telangana State Engineering, Agriculture and Medical Common Entrance Test (TS EAMCET) serves as the primary gateway for thousands of aspirants seeking admission into premier undergraduate engineering, pharmacy, and agriculture courses across the state. Participating institutes span state university campuses, autonomous engineering institutions, and private affiliated colleges approved by the All India Council for Technical Education (AICTE). When shortlisting colleges accepting TS EAMCET scores, candidates must evaluate multiple parameters beyond generic state rankings, including category-wise seat allotment, tuition fee reimbursement eligibility through TS EAMCET counselling, infrastructure standards, and branch-specific placement records.

Students must navigate web options carefully during the TS EAMCET counselling process administered by the Department of Technical Education, Telangana. Analyzing previous years' closing ranks, institutional accreditation status (such as NAAC grading and NBA certification for specific departments), and historical student-to-faculty ratios helps students select colleges that offer genuine long-term academic and career value rather than relying solely on promotional brochures.

Key Points for Students
  • ✓Verify institutional approvals from UGC, AICTE, and state governing bodies.
  • ✓Check historical closing ranks for specific streams like Computer Science, AI/ML, and Core Engineering.
  • ✓Evaluate hostel availability, campus safety, and modern lab infrastructure.

Top-Ranked Engineering Colleges Accepting TS EAMCET Score

According to official NIRF benchmarks, UGC notifications, and institutional placement disclosures, top-tier colleges accepting TS EAMCET scores maintain rigorous academic standards and robust corporate recruitment pipelines. State university campuses like JNTUH College of Engineering (Hyderabad) and Osmania University College of Engineering lead the public sector, offering exceptional academic rigor paired with highly subsidized fee structures. Meanwhile, premier private engineering colleges such as CBIT, VNR VJIET, Vasavi College of Engineering, and Bhoj Reddy Engineering College for Women attract major multinational recruiters through specialized industry-aligned curricula and active placement cells.

Step-by-Step Practical Decision Framework

Actionable steps to evaluate institutions before applying

1Step 1

Step 1: Map Your TS EAMCET Rank

Compare your normalized exam rank with previous 3 years' opening and closing ranks for your desired branch across university and private categories.

2Step 2

Step 2: Audit Verified Placement Disclosures

Examine audited institutional placement percentages, median CTC figures, and core vs IT company bifurcation rather than peak packages.

3Step 3

Step 3: Calculate Net Tuition and Living Costs

Factor in tuition fee reimbursement eligibility, hostel expenses, and daily transit to compute true financial return on investment.

Frequently Asked Questions

Clear answers to common student admission questions

What is the minimum qualifying mark for TS EAMCET counselling?
Candidates belonging to the general category typically require 25% of the maximum marks (40 out of 160) to qualify in TS EAMCET. However, there is no minimum qualifying mark prescribed for candidates belonging to Scheduled Castes (SC) and Scheduled Tribes (ST).
Can students from other states apply to colleges accepting TS EAMCET scores?
Yes, non-Telangana students can apply under the Management Quota (B-Category seats) in private engineering colleges accepting TS EAMCET scores or through separate national entrance norms. State quota counseling seats are strictly reserved for candidates fulfilling local and non-local domicile criteria of Telangana and Andhra Pradesh.
How is tuition fee reimbursement determined for TS EAMCET qualified candidates?
Eligible students whose parental income falls below specified state thresholds (typically below ₹2 Lakhs per annum for backward classes and economically weaker sections) receive full tuition fee reimbursement directly through the Telangana government ePASS portal during counselling.
